  • Patent number: 6965518
    Abstract: A power converter with output voltage level indicating device is disclosed. The power converter includes a casing, an interior of which is disposed with a control circuit. The control circuit includes a feedback circuit and a DC-to-DC conversion circuit. The feedback circuit is coupled to the DC-to-DC conversion circuit and connected to a level-selecting terminal by at least one resistor to provide a feedback signal to the DC-to-DC conversion circuit which in turn changes the voltage level of the DC output. An output socket is formed at the casing, which is connected with the control circuit. The output socket includes two primary, power terminals and at least one secondary, level-selecting terminals. A level-selecting terminal device is connected to the output socket via an extension cable for getting the DC voltage and supplying the DC voltage to an appliance via an output terminal.

  • Patent number: 6856298
    Abstract: A dual band linear antenna array, having a set of radiator constructed by four elongate metal plates. The metal plates are arranged to form a rectangular array. By serially connecting to a signal feed terminal, the roots of the metal plates are connected to a copper tube via a coaxial cable external conductor (ground signal). One pair of the metal plates has the same length, which is about one quarter wavelength of the high-frequency electric wave received thereby and transmitted therefrom. The other pair of the metal plates has longer length at about one quarter wavelength of a low-frequency electric wave received thereby and transmitted therefrom. Thereby, an array of dual band antenna is obtained to achieve omni-directional reception and transmission of radiation.

  • Patent number: 6853348
    Abstract: A dual band linear antenna array, having a set of radiator constructed by four hard linear conductors. The linear conductors are equidistantly arranged at four corners and extend parallel to each other. By serially connecting to a signal feed terminal, the roots of the linear conductors are connected to a copper tube via a coaxial cable external conductor (ground signal). Three of the linear conductors have the same length, which is about one quarter wavelength of the high-frequency electric wave received thereby and transmitted therefrom. The other linear conductor has the length longer than these three linear conductors at about one quarter wavelength of a low-frequency electric wave received thereby and transmitted therefrom. Thereby, an array of dual band antenna is obtained to achieve omni-directional reception and transmission of radiation.

  • Patent number: 6791296
    Abstract: A cell phone charging circuit of a USB interface. The charging circuit is supplied with a DC power of 5V via the USB interface and split into two, one has a first resister R1 connected to an emitter of a PNP transistor Q1 in series, and the other has two serially connected diodes D1 and D2. The diodes D1 and D2 have a negative thermal coefficient. The negative electrode of the diode D1 is connected to the base of the transistor, the collector of the transistor serves as a charging output terminal, such that the emitter voltage VEB of the transistor Q1 is the same as the voltage VD2 of the diode D2. Therefore, the current flowing through the resistor is VD1/R1, and the voltage and current limiting function is obtained. When the temperature of the battery increases for charging, the voltage VD1 is reduced to decrease the output current, such that temperature compensation is achieved.
